HIGH SCHOOL

Daunte Bell, Millikan Baseball

Daunte Bell continued his pitching dominance in Millikan’s CIF-SS Division 3 quarterfinal against Summit. The southpaw threw a complete game shutout in the gutsy 1-0 win.

AJ Nonato, Millikan Baseball

Sophomore AJ Nonato has been key in Millikan’s playoff success and was a big part of their CIF-SS Division 3 quarterfinal win. Nonato started the Rams’ go-ahead rally in the 5th with a leadoff single and made three incredible plays on defense in the final two innings to secure the victory.

Cooper George, Wilson Baseball

Cooper George is Wilson’s ace and proved why in the Bruins’ CIF-SS Division 5 quarterfinal win. George went the distance in a complete game performance where he totaled up 11 strikeouts in the 6-1 victory against Temescal Canyon.

James Mirable, Wilson Baseball

The Wilson Bruins got a dominant 6-1 win vs. Temescal Canyon in their CIF-SS Division 5 quarterfinal, and senior James Mirable helped fuel his team on offense. Mirable was 2-for-2 at the plate with a pair of runs to contribute to the victory.

Xavier Nunez, Lakewood Baseball

Xavier Nunez delivered on both sides of the ball for the Lancers in their CIF-SS Division 6 quarterfinal win. Nunez held the game down through four solid innings on the mound, also going 3-for-4 at the plate with two runs in Lakewood’s hard-fought 5-3 win over Muir.

Nick Gallegos, Lakewood Baseball

The Lakewood Lancers beat the John Muir Mustangs in a head-to-head battle for the CIF-SS Division 6 quarterfinal matchup. The Lancers relied on their entire team to pull off the 5-3 win, and Nick Gallegos did his part going 2-for-3 at the plate with an RBI.

COLLEGE

Steen Zeman, CSULB Men’s Golf

Steen Zeman finished in a Top 5 spot at the NCAA Columbus Regional to earn an Individual spot in the NCAA Championships. Zeman will be just the second Beach representative to play in the NCAA Championship in the modern format, securing his spot on a 3-under par 68 and final round of 74. 

Elisa Portillo, CSULB Women’s Water Polo

Senior Elisa Portillo had a historical season for Long Beach State Women’s Water Polo and was honored for it this week. Portillo led the Beach with 74 goals, 54 assists, 40 steals and seven blocks in her final season with the Beach, earning her third All-American selection after being named to the Second Team.
